Course Description: This course covers the following topics; approximations and error, roots of equations, solving systems of linear equations, curve fitting, and interpolation, numerical differentiation, and integration, solving ordinary differential equations, initial value problems, and boundary value problems. The applications of listed topics are carried out using MATLAB.
Textbook: Richard L. Burden - J. Douglas Faires, Numerical Analysis, 9th Edition, Cengage Learning 2010, ISBN: 978-0538733519
Reference Book: E. Ward Cheney - David R. Kincaid , Numerical Mathematics and Computing 6th Edition, Brooks Cole, 2007, ISBN: 978-0495114758
